Output 29927a87682a4ee7bb9c1f699ef2bef5cb46b41214a2c31da93ce80320e5e683:1

value
63803443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b6b1de4f8225f892424e18d16a38af28c0d221f OP_EQUAL
address
35ebJPwycmK9ws6B3rcqqEdaJfbwuC1bbQ
transaction
29927a87682a4ee7bb9c1f699ef2bef5cb46b41214a2c31da93ce80320e5e683
confirmations
309351
spent
true